Recently Aishwarya Rai-Bachchan refused to endorose a fairness cream. In a country which is unjustly obsessed with fair skin, Aishwarya recently took a firm stand. She refused to be the Indian face of a skin-lightening cream by a global cosmetic company.

After Aishwarya turned down the offer, the cosmetic company signed Sonam Kapoor to endorse the fairness cream. The cosmetic company is positioning Sonam as a ‘young face’, as opposed to Aishwarya who may now be called the ‘older face’ of the cosmetic industry.

However, a source reveals that the key factor behind Sonam being the new face has got nothing to do with her age.

Revealing the real reason for Aishwarya’s refusal and Sonam’s subsequent approval, our source said, “It was the fairness cream that bothered Aishwarya. She said that she didn’t want to promote a fairness cream especially in India where one’s skin colour is such a big issue. She will never promote a product that discriminates on the basis of one’s skin colour. Ours is a society where biases are so prevalent that she will do all she can to curb it.”

“When Aishwarya refused to relent, the cosmetic company was forced to get Sonam into the picture. They need an Indian face for the promotion and Sonam was the next ideal choice,” said our source.

When contacted, A i s hw a r y a refused to comment as she is contract-bound. Commenting on how Aishwarya has reacted to this, the source said, “Such stories seldom bother her. Aishwarya is primarily guided by her sense of ethics as far as advertising is concerned. She does not endorse products unless she believes in them. She was recently offered a fortune to replace Rani Mukherjee to endorse a popular mosquito repellent cream, but she turned down the offer.”

Aishwarya to appear in Ravan


Aishwarya Rai Bachchan is getting ready for Mani Ratnam's next film, Raavan. The film is a sensuous contemporary Hindi take on the Ramayana, in which Aishwarya will be playing a classical singer for the first time in her career.

Aishwarya wants to excel in every role she plays. A source says, "Aishwarya will be learning classical singing for this role. Ideally, she'd like to sing all her songs in Raavan, herself. She's a very good singer in real life. But not good enough to sing classical songs on screen with aplomb. So, like Shabana Azmi in Morning Raga Aishwarya intends to take lessons in how to look convincing as a singer. She'll be regularly taking lessons in classical singing from a guru."Aishwarya will also do riyaaz before she starts shooting for Raavan in October.

Aishwarya Rai Bachchan exited over Pink Panther 2

Aishwarya Rai Bachchan, who recently completed Sarkar Raj for Bollywood with her legendary father-in-law Amitabh Bachchan, is now looking forward to her Hollywood release Pink Panther 2 with that great actor Steve Martin.


The beautiful actress cannot stop raving about the veteran American actor. “He’s fantastic. An institution. He has unbelievable comic timing and such energy. It’s incredible how hard he works at his age on the physical comedy. Just like Pa! Pink Panther 2 is completely Steve Martin’s film,” said Aishwarya Rai, adding, “what makes my role special is that they haven’t specified my nationality. Nor have I been made to put on any accent. In fact, every other character is culture-specific. Except mine. That was really nice. We all have done our best. And when we started shooting in Paris, Abhishek Bachchan was with me, so it was very nice.”

However, Ash refuses to admit that Pink Panther 2 being an international project was extra special to her. “I’m not one to compare assignments. For me Chokher Bali in Kolkata was as precious as Pink Panther 2 in Boston. But, yes, Gurinder Chadha’s Bride & Prejudice and her husband’s Mistress Of Spices had a lot of Indians in the crew, so I felt at home.” And to set the record straight, Ash said, “ The Last Legion with Sir Ben Kingsley was my first fully-fledged international project. It was such a fantastic experience.”
